A packet-scheduling scheme that determines the order of servicing of incoming packets in an intermediate node plays a vital role in deciding the queuing delay experienced by a packet in a Wireless Sensor Network. In case of Real-time WSN applications, minimizing the End-to-End delay is a major concern to meet the required bounded time constraints. Therefore, a Real-time packet-scheduling scheme has to schedule the incoming packets effectively based upon their deadline by minimizing the queuing delay incurred at each node. In this paper, we presented the role of Real-time packet scheduling policy for Real-time Wireless Sensor Networks and we proposed an effective scheduling scheme that aids to Real-time data communication. Simulation result shows that the proposed scheduling policy works better in terms of average delay, packet drop ratio and packet miss ratio.
